WebIn connection with the more specific proposition, namely, that future generations have rights to specific assets, such as the existing environment and all its creatures, a second condition has to be satisfied. This is that even people who do exist cannot have rights to anything unless, in principle, the rights could be fulfilled (Parfit 1984: 365). There are cases of economies responding to economic crisis by increasing government borrowing and financing the increased debt by printing money. If output is falling and inflation rising, and the government responds by printing more money to finance debt, then it can cause …
